In this comparison, we are comparing a tyre from a manufacturer from Germany (
Continental) against a tyre from a manufacturer from South Korea (
Hankook). Generally,
Continental summer tyres are slightly better rated (92%) than
Hankook (80%). The first tyre test of Continental PremiumContact 5 was done in 2019, compared to 2025 when was the Hankook ION Evo first tested. When it comes to comparison, eu labels can be also interesting - 70% of Continental PremiumContact 5 dimensions has A wet grip rating. Most (98%) of the Hankook ION Evo also have A wet ratings. If you wonder where the tyres in question are made, the
PremiumContact 5 is made in Czech Republic and
ION Evo is made in Hungary.
